White House senior adviser Jared Kushner tells TODAY that peace deals brokered by President Trump between Israel and Bahrain and the United Arab Emirates are the “beginning of the end of the Israel-Arab conflict.” Regarding the president’s indoor rallies despite coronavirus concerns, he says “the president believes Americans can make their own decisions.” He also praises Trump’s leadership on the coronavirus, saying that “we’ve seen cases come down tremendously” and hailing progress on a vaccine. Kushner also talks about Bob Woodward’s new book “Rage,” claiming that Woodward “mischaracterizes” which Trump advisers Kushner was referring to as “overconfident idiots.”Sept. 15, 2020
